A six armed hollow bronze cross with ball finials, obverse centre featuring two embossed Chinese characters translating to "To Make Known that Which is Beautiful", with surround stating INDOCHINE FRANCAISE, with a mirrored reverse, with a swivel suspension composed of two laurel branches, measuring 47 mm (w) x 67 mm (h inclusive of suspension), on period ribbon, with minor
